Tanglewood schedule – Ozawa Hall highlights

Whereas the venerable Koussevitsky Music Shed, dedicated in 1938, is the primary venue at Tanglewood, performances in Seiji Ozawa Hall, opened in 1994, are highlights of the Tanglewood season and often examples of innovative programming.

On July 5, 7, & 9, violinist Christian Tetzlaff, with pianist Alexander Lonquich, will present Beethoven’s complete Sonatas for Violin and Piano. On June 28, the Juilliard Quartet presents a program of Haydn’s Sun Quartets; it will be the farewell performance of first violinist Joel Smirnoff.

Le Concert de Nations, the period-instrument ensemble led by Jordi Savall presents wide-ranging concerts on July 14 & 15. Actor F. Murray Abraham will join the ensemble for Stage Music in the Plays of William Shakespeare.

On August 5 & 6, the Mark Morris Dance Group will return to Tanglewood with two world premieres choreographed to music of Ives and Beethoven, featuring performances by cellist Yo-Yo Ma and pianist Emanuel Ax.
